Overview

Terrain analysis provides a number of features that enable you to get a better understanding of the terrain on which you want to devise your system of attack or defense. You can use these functions to display color-coded elevation data of what is visible and what is not visible from a given point, to display areas of sight covering 360 degrees about a selected point, and to compute gradient and valley information for selected areas.
In addition, you can create cuts through a terrain that display color-coded elevation data along a polyline, create 3D views and change their display angle and tilt, and simulate the trajectory of ground based or airborne objects.
